根据特定模式忽略方法上的checkstyle,可以通过以下步骤进行操作:
<module name="Checker">
<!-- 其他配置项 -->
<module name="SuppressionFilter">
<property name="file" value="checkstyle_suppressions.xml"/>
</module>
</module>
checkstyle_suppressions.xml
是一个自定义的文件,用于定义要忽略的规则。在该文件中,可以指定要忽略的规则、文件、类、方法等。以下是一个示例规则文件的片段:<suppressions>
<suppress checks="SomeCheck" files="SomeClass.java" />
<suppress checks="AnotherCheck" files="AnotherClass.java" />
<suppress checks="YetAnotherCheck" methods="someMethod" />
</suppressions>
在上述示例中,SomeCheck
、AnotherCheck
和YetAnotherCheck
是要忽略的具体规则,SomeClass.java
和AnotherClass.java
是要忽略的文件,someMethod
是要忽略的方法。
总结起来,根据特定模式忽略方法上的checkstyle,需要了解checkstyle的基本概念和规则,配置checkstyle的忽略规则文件,并将其与项目关联起来,最后运行checkstyle来检查代码并应用忽略规则。这样可以在特定模式下忽略方法上的checkstyle检查,以满足项目的需求。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云